Abstract

An experiment was carried out to study the effect of pre-harvest management in carnation (Dianthus caryophyllus L) cv Malaga to improve the flower yield, quality and vase life by the foliar application of biostimulants. In the preharvest treatments, Panchagavya @ 2 per cent + Manchurian mushroom tea 4 per cent with RDF (NPK 19:19:19 @ 8 g, calcium nitrate 1.5 g, potassium nitrate 1.0 g, monopotassium phosphate 1.5 g, borax 0.5 g, magnesium sulphate 2.5 g) proved superior in respect of flower yield parameters viz lesser days taken to bud opening (157.8), maximum flower diameter (6.54 cm), highest stem length (84.90 cm), maximum number of petals per flower (73.83), maximum number of flowers per plant (11.53), maximum number of flowers per m2 (415.20) and longest duration of flowering (80.87 days). This treatment also resulted in lowest disease incidence (2.42%).
